2024 Oscars Nominations Unveiled: “Oppenheimer” Takes the Lead with 13 Nods

Hollywood: The anticipation surrounding the 2024 Oscars reached its peak as the nominations were officially announced today. The highly acclaimed film “Oppenheimer” secured the spotlight with an impressive 13 nominations, closely followed by “Poor Things” with 11 nods. The 96th annual Academy Awards come on the heels of a remarkable cinematic year, featuring the “Barbenheimer” phenomenon and Christopher Nolan’s epic World War II biopic, both of which enjoyed substantial success at the global box office.

The list of nominations revealed several surprises, including the absence of “Barbie” director Greta Gerwig and no acting nods for stars like Margot Robbie and Leonardo DiCaprio. On the other hand, America Ferrera earned a best supporting actress nomination for her role in “Barbie” after being overlooked for a Golden Globe nomination. Here is the complete list of nominees for the 2024 Oscars:

Best Picture

“American Fiction”
“Anatomy of a Fall”
“Barbie”
“The Holdovers”
“Killers of the Flower Moon”
“Maestro”
“Oppenheimer”
“Past Lives”
“Poor Things”
“The Zone of Interest”

Best Actor

Bradley Cooper, “Maestro”
Colman Domingo, “Rustin”
Paul Giamatti, “The Holdovers”
Cillian Murphy, “Oppenheimer”
Jeffrey Wright, “American Fiction”

Best Actress

Annette Bening, “Nyad”
Lily Gladstone, “Killers of the Flower Moon”
Sandra Hüller, “Anatomy of a Fall”
Carey Mulligan, “Maestro”
Emma Stone, “Poor Things”
